Job description

Are you a seasoned coding leader ready to make a significant impact from home? PeaceHealth seeks a dynamic Manager of Hospital Coding to lead a remote team, ensuring accuracy, compliance, and team empowerment.

Why PeaceHealth?

Join a mission-driven organization committed to compassionate care. Enjoy a competitive salary ($94,000 - $140,000 annually, depending on experience) and a comprehensive benefits package supporting your well-being.

Your Impact:

Lead and mentor 29 hospital coders for timely and accurate coding
Champion compliance with PeaceHealth and regulatory standards
Optimize revenue through improved coding and documentation
Resolve discrepancies and collaborate with auditing bodies
Drive coding compliance education across the organization


What You Offer:

Bachelor's degree (or equivalent experience).
5+ years medical coding expertise.
2+ years leadership experience.
One of the following: RHIA, CCS, or RHIT certification.
Epic EMR proficiency.
Deep knowledge of ICD-10-CM, CPT4/HCPCS, and reimbursement systems.
Exceptional communication and problem-solving skills.
Residency in OR, WA, AK, or TX required.
